Walker wins state title in 800

Richmond Hill High School senior Shaquille Walker won his second consecutive state 800 title Friday at the boys' state Class AAAA track meet in Jefferson. Last year, Walker won the 800 in Class AAA.

Four Wildcats qualify for Class AAAA track meet

Different classification, same result. Defending state 800 champ Shaquille Walker won his fourth straight region title at the Region 2-AAAA track and field meet April 22-23 in Statesboro. Walker's previous three titles were in Region 3-AAA. His time of 1:52.71 at the 2-AAAA meet was nearly1 15 seconds faster than that of the runner up.
